Everton vs Newcastle United Match Preview

Updated: Mar 17, 2022

After the Magpies suffered a devastating loss at the hands of Chelsea and VAR on Sunday, focus must now turn to Goodison Park as Newcastle face Everton.


It’s a tale of two sides who are heading in opposite direction as Newcastle, baring last weekends defeat to Chelsea, were unbeaten in eight games and are currently nine points clear of the relegation zone. Everton on the other hand are in 17th place after a poor run of results but are level on points with 18th placed Watford. The Toffees have lost eight of their last nine premier league fixtures after their defeat at the weekend to Wolverhampton Wanderers. They have also failed to score in their last four top flight fixtures.



Everton have not beaten Newcastle on their home turf since April 2018. The Magpies won the reverse fixture 3-1 just over a month ago which takes it to three Premier League victories in a row against The Toffees, the last time Newcastle won four in a row against them was between 1989-1995.


Everton Team News: Frank Lampard will be without defender Kenny after he was sent off against the defeat to Wolves, Michael Keane could take his place. Dominic Calvert-Lewin is doubtful for this match as he recovers from an illness. Dele Alli could return to the line up. Anthony Gordon, Richarlison and Demarai Grey will be hoping to find their goalscoring form to escape the rut they find themselves in.



Newcastle Team News: Eddie Howe will have to made a late call on Joelinton as he recovers from a groin injury. Joe Willock is expected to be named in the match day squad after his illness bout. Jonjo Shelvey is still out. Bruno Guimaraes and Sean Longstaff are expected to hold their spots in the starting eleven.
